1

Scaling Kilimanjaro: Your Ultimate Handbook

News Discuss 
Embarking on a journey to the "Roof of Africa," Mount Kilimanjaro, is a remarkable achievement. This handbook aims to arm you with the essential information needed for a memorable ascent. From selecting the right https://www.travelstride.com/

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story